Analysis

The most recent figure for ratio of total weekly hours worked to population aged 15-64 in Barbados is 26.32, measured in 2027.

Compared with earlier readings it is up 0.1% on the previous year and up 1.0% over ten years.

Over the whole period, ratio of total weekly hours worked to population aged 15-64 in Barbados peaked at 28.54 in 2007 and was at its lowest, 22.89, in 2021.

Barbados ranks 81st of 188 countries on this measure, in the middle of the range.

The long-run direction has been consistently falling across the 23 years of available data.

Imputed observations are not based on national data, are subject to high uncertainty and should not be used for country comparisons or rankings. This series is based on the 13th ICLS definitions. The ratio of total weekly hours worked to population aged 15-64 is the total weekly hours worked by employed persons in their main job divided by the population aged 15-64.
